Around 40 exhibitors will present projects, offers and services at Friedensplatz
On Saturday, June 20, 2026, HEAG, together with the City of Darmstadt, will once again host the Urban Business Day at Friedensplatz. From 10 a.m. to 3 p.m., around 40 exhibitors will present their products, projects, and services. Admission is free.
The event brings together Darmstadt's municipal companies and numerous partners with citizens. Visitors can expect a diverse program of information and activities for the whole family.
Insights into the work of the city's economy
The official opening will take place at 11 a.m. by Mayor Hanno Benz. The event will be accompanied musically by musicians from the Academy of Music.
“Whether it’s a reliable energy supply, affordable housing, modern mobility, functioning infrastructure, or numerous other services – our municipal companies make an indispensable contribution to the quality of life in Darmstadt every day. The Day of Municipal Economy offers the opportunity to showcase this diversity and engage in dialogue with the people,” explains Mayor Hanno Benz.
HEAG also emphasizes the importance of municipal companies for the city's community. Board members Prof. Dr. Klaus-Michael Ahrend and Dr. Markus Hoschek point out that the day of action makes the diverse services provided by the city's economy tangible and promotes direct interaction with residents.
Numerous companies and institutions are represented
In addition to HEAG, other companies presenting at the event include ENTEGA, bauverein AG, HEAG mobilo, Klinikum Darmstadt, darmstadtium, Centralstation and several municipal enterprises of the city of Darmstadt.
At the Darmstadt booth, visitors can learn about the neighborhood app and the city's business portal. The Darmstadt Clinic and the Agaplesion Elisabethenstift will present the da Vinci surgical robot. The HUB31 technology and startup center will provide information about its activities to support startups.
Interactive activities for the whole family
The supporting program also offers numerous attractions. Among those present are the Darmstadt professional fire brigade, the city library's bookmobile, and the mobile fan shop of SV Darmstadt 98. Musical entertainment will be provided by the band "Walk-a-Tones".
Children can look forward to a bouncy castle, the mobile play unit, the teddy bear hospital, and the opportunity to create their own bottle garden.
